About Arrondissement Of Sarreguemines, France

Tucked away in the charming Lorraine region of northeastern France, the Arrondissement of Sarreguemines offers a delightful escape from the usual tourist trail. This area boasts a unique blend of French and German influences, reflected in its architecture, cuisine, and culture. Imagine strolling through picturesque villages, discovering hidden historical gems, and experiencing the warmth of local hospitality. It's a region perfect for those seeking an authentic French experience, away from the hustle and bustle of larger cities. Get ready to explore a region rich in history, natural beauty, and a captivating blend of cultures.

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Arrondissement Of Sarreguemines, France

The Arrondissement of Sarreguemines is brimming with places to explore. Here are some highlights:

  • Sarreguemines Pottery Museum: Discover the rich history of Sarreguemines' renowned pottery, a significant part of the region's heritage.
  • Château de Blies-Guersviller: Explore this majestic castle, a testament to the region's fascinating past. Its architecture and grounds offer a captivating glimpse into history.
  • The Sarre River: Enjoy scenic walks or bike rides along the banks of the Sarre, taking in the tranquil beauty of the natural landscape.
  • Local Churches and Chapels: Many charming villages boast beautiful churches and chapels, showcasing stunning architecture and peaceful atmospheres.
  • The surrounding villages: Each village offers its own unique charm, from quaint streets to local markets. Take your time to explore and discover hidden gems.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Arrondissement Of Sarreguemines, France

The cuisine of the Lorraine region is a delightful blend of French and German influences. Be sure to sample local specialties like Quiche Lorraine, Baeckeoffe (a hearty stew), and local wines. Explore local markets and restaurants to discover hidden culinary gems.

Best Time to Visit Arrondissement Of Sarreguemines, France

The best time to visit is during the spring or autumn months for pleasant weather and fewer crowds. Summer can be warm, while winter can be cold and potentially snowy.

Transportation Options in Arrondissement Of Sarreguemines, France

Getting around the Arrondissement of Sarreguemines is easiest by car, allowing you to explore the region's many villages at your own pace.
